Dowiedz się, jak Twoja aplikacja internetowa w Chrome może przekazywać atrybucje do aplikacji na Androida.
Piaskownica prywatności natywnie obsługuje atrybucję z internetu do aplikacji i z aplikacji do internetu, a interfejs Attribution Reporting API umożliwia pomiary w przeglądarkach mobilnych i aplikacjach na Androida.
Czym jest atrybucja przechodzenia z reklamy do aplikacji?
Jeśli użytkownik kliknie reklamę w mobilnej przeglądarce Chrome, a potem dokona zakupu w aplikacji na Androida, interfejs Attribution Reporting API może bezpośrednio przypisać tę konwersję w aplikacji na Androida do reklam wyświetlanych w mobilnej przeglądarce Chrome. To atrybucja typu „sieć – aplikacja”.
Podobnie jeśli użytkownik kliknie reklamę w aplikacji na Androida, a następnie dokona zakupu w przeglądarce Chrome na urządzeniu mobilnym, interfejs Attribution Reporting API może bezpośrednio przypisać tę konwersję. To atrybucja z aplikacji do internetu.
Interfejs API rejestruje atrybucje z internetu do aplikacji, gdy występują na tym samym urządzeniu.
Jak wdrożyć atrybucję z internetu do aplikacji?
Aby zaimplementować atrybucję z internetu do aplikacji, najpierw upewnij się, że w kodzie internetowym dostępny jest pomiar z internetu do aplikacji i z aplikacji do internetu.
Aby to zrobić, podczas rejestrowania zdarzenia w żądaniu wysyłanym do źródła raportowania uwzględnij nagłówek Attribution-Reporting-Eligible.
Przeglądarka będzie rozgłaszać, czy obsługa na poziomie systemu operacyjnego jest dostępna dla serwera pochodzenia raportowania, za pomocą nagłówka żądania o strukturze słownika.
Następnie zarejestruj kliknięcie reklamy, rejestrując źródło.
Jeśli obsługa systemu operacyjnego jest dostępna, źródło raportowania powinno odesłać odpowiedź z nagłówkiem strukturalnym w postaci ciągu znaków Attribution-Reporting-Register-OS-Source, który zawiera adres URL wskazujący miejsce rejestracji źródła.
Odpowiedź jest podobna do odpowiedzi, jaką otrzymałby źródło raportowania podczas pomiaru w internecie, ale w tym przypadku wskazuje, że raportowaniem powinien zająć się system operacyjny Android, a nie przeglądarka Chrome.
Metadane odpowiedzi obejmują miejsca docelowe w internecie i w aplikacji. Te pola docelowe określają witrynę i pakiet aplikacji, w których będzie wywoływana atrybucja dla źródła.
Nagłówek Attribution-Reporting-Register-OS-Source informuje system operacyjny Android, że ma wywołać funkcję rejestracji źródła internetowego, która pobiera metadane z nagłówka i pakuje je, aby wysłać do adresu URL technologii reklamowej określonego w parametrze Attribution-Reporting-Register-OS-Source. Nie musisz dzwonić bezpośrednio pod numer registerWebSource().
Dalsze kroki
- Więcej informacji o atrybucji z witryny do aplikacji znajdziesz w artykule Pomiar atrybucji w aplikacjach i witrynach.
- Zapoznaj się też z artykułem Raportowanie atrybucji: pomiary w aplikacjach i witrynach.